To develop a more effective crisis communications strategy, we need to understand trust. When a crisis occurs, it’s generally because of two very broad reasons: something we’ve said, or something we’ve done. But what do we respond to? Failure of performance , an inability to generate the promised results.

If you don't monitor reviews about your business regularly, it's time to start doing so during a crisis. Delegate Handling a crisis is not a one-person job, even if you are the company's owner and CEO. Having a crisis managing team of key employees with all relevant information would be best.
